Nov 7, 2016Volunteering During Natural Disasters
When a natural disaster strikes, it’s natural to feel the need to help out, especially if you are near the affected areas. Countless amounts of people decide to contact various organizations in an effort to try to volunteer onsite. Some people even feel the urgent need to hop in their vehicles and get there as soon as possible! It’s important to keep in mind, however, volunteers needed in a specific area need to be aware of the various factors that can hinder and help in a disaster situation.

Oct 20, 2016Voluntourism: Construction and Renovation in Laos
Laos has been struggling to recover from the devastation of the Vietnam War for decades, but many organizations are finally jumping on board to help get the country back on its feet. Its rich culture, affordable costs and beautiful scenery draw millions of visitors each year, so why not take the opportunity to visit and rebuild at the same time?

Sep 24, 2016Teach in Cambodia
Cambodia is an oft-visited country in Southeast Asia in desperate need of teachers. The families here experienced decades of economic hardship after fighting expensive and devastating wars, but have made wonderful efforts to overcome the odds. However, the children often lack basic educational opportunities, which is why Travellers Worldwide is hoping to send folks over to give them a hand.
